Nuclear radiation detector mechanical environment test

Nuclear radiation detector mechanical environment test-Reliability Testing-

Test Background

Detector mechanical environment tests include steady-state vibration (sinusoidal), road transportation environment after complete packaging according to transportation requirements, unsteady vibration (including impact), free fall, drop, dumping and static load after complete packaging according to transportation requirements, as well as angular motion and constant acceleration, etc.

Trial objective

Vibration test: Determine the detector's adaptability to vibration and evaluate its structural integrity (including studying its dynamic performance characteristics).
Impact test: Determine the detector's adaptability to withstand multiple non-repetitive mechanical impacts during use and evaluate its structural integrity.
Free drop test: Determine the detector's adaptability to withstand drops during use and evaluate its structural integrity.

Scope of tests

Vibration test: Applicable to products that will be subjected to vibrations due to rotation, pulsation and oscillation forces (such as those that may occur on ground vehicles, ships or aircraft) during use, or products that are subject to sinusoidal steady-state vibrations caused by mechanical or seismic phenomena.
Impact test and free drop test: mainly used for non-packaged test samples, and can also be used for test samples that are packaged as part of it.

Test standard:

GB/T 10263-2006 Nuclear radiation detector environmental conditions and test methods
GB/T 2424.26-2008 Environmental testing of electrical and electronic products Part 3: Supporting documents and guidelines Vibration test selection
GB/T 2423.58-2008 Environmental testing of electrical and electronic products Part 2: Test method Test Fi: Vibration Mixed mode
GB/T 2423.59-2008 Environmental testing of electrical and electronic products Part 2: Test method Test Z/ABMFh: Temperature (low temperature, high temperature)/low pressure/vibration (random) comprehensive
GB/T 2423.57-2008 Environmental testing of electrical and electronic products Part 2-81: Test method Test Ei: Shock Shock response spectrum synthesis
GB/T 4937 Mechanical and climatic test methods for semiconductor devices Desktop drop test methods for components used in handheld electronic products
